I'd suspected the implementation is a fair amount more complicated than it should, and the way I read it it has issues with multibyte characters. So I wrote this: String[] outdent(String)(String[] lines) if (isSomeString!String)
{
size_t minLeadingSpaces = size_t.max;
foreach (line; lines)
{
size_t leadingSpaces = 0;
foreach (dchar c; line)
{
if (std.uni.isSpace(c))
{
++leadingSpaces;
}
else
{
if (leadingSpaces < minLeadingSpaces)
{
minLeadingSpaces = leadingSpaces;
}
break;
}
}
}
if (!minLeadingSpaces || minLeadingSpaces == size_t.max)
{
return lines;
}
foreach (ref line; lines)
{
line.popFrontN(minLeadingSpaces);
}
return lines;
}
String outdent(String)(String s) if (isSomeString!String)
{
auto lines = outdent(splitLines(s));
s = join(lines, "\n");
if (s.endsWith('\n')) s ~= '\n';
return s;
}You may want to adapt it for this submission. Thanks. |
